Objective:To evaluate the potential differential diagnostic value of QuantiFERON-TB Gold Plus(QFT-Plus) in patients with active tuberculosis (ATB) and latent tuberculosis infection (LTBI) people.Methods:Case-control study. A total of 108 healthcare workers and 30 ATB patients in Xi′an Chest Hospital were tested by QFT-Plus from April to November 2019, and the demographic characteristics were analyzed.Then, flow cytometry was used to analyze the relations between the QFT-Plus TB2-TB1 and the distribution of peripheral blood T lymphocyte subsets in ATB patients with positive culture results.Finally, with 34 QFT-Plus positive volunteers as LTBI group and 30 bacteriologically confirmed ATB patients as ATB group, the QFT-Plus new lyadded antigen and its potential differential diagnostic value between LTBI and ATB groups was evaluated by using the receiver operating curve (ROC).Results:In patients with ATB,QFT-plus TB2-TB1 was positively correlated with the proportion of CD8+T cells in peripheral blood T lymphocytes( r=0.586, P=0.004), negatively correlated with the proportion of CD4+ T cells( r=-0.511, P=0.015) and the ratio of CD4/CD8 ( r=-0.520, P=0.013).The peripheral blood TB2-TB1 in the ATB patients was significantly higher than that in the LTBI group[0.47(0.12,1.17) IU/ml versus 0.01(-0.08,0.22) IU/ml, U=233.5, P<0.001]. QFT-Plus TB2-TB1 can effectively distinguish ATB from LTBI, with an area under the ROC curve of 0.771 (95 %CI=0.653-0.889, P<0.001). Conclusion:QFT-Plus specific CD8 response (TB2-TB1) has the potential value to identify ATB from LTBI people.

Objective@#To investigate the fatigue status of military personnel stationed in plateau and high cold region, and to analyze the mediator effect of trait coping style on job stress and fatigue.@*Methods@#In October 2010, with the method of cluster random sampling survey, 531 military personnel stationed in plateau and high cold region were chosen as subject. The fatigue status were evaluated by the Chinese version multidimensional fatigue inventory (MFI-20) , job stress were evaluated by the Job Stress Survey (JSS) , and trait coping style were evaluated by the Trait Coping Style Questionnaire (TCSQ) .@*Results@#According to the information of different population characteristics, mean rank of physical fatigue about the urban (town) group were higher than that of rural group (Z=-2.200, P<0.05) ; mean rank of reduced motivation about the urban (town) group were higher than that of rural group (Z=-2.781, P<0.05) ; mean rank of general fatigue scores about the urban (town) group were higher than that of rural group (Z=-3.026, P<0.05) ; mean rank of physical fatigue about the up or equal 20-years old age group were higher than that of below 20-years old age group (Z=-4.045, P<0.05) ; mean rank of reduced motivation about the up or equal 20-years old age group were higher than that of below 20-years old age group (Z=-2.182, P<0.05) ; mean rank of mental fatigue about the up or equal 20-years old age group were higher than that of below 20-years old age group (Z=-2.879, P<0.05) ; mean rank of general fatigue scores about the up or equal 20-years old age group were higher than that of below 20-years old age group (Z=-3.647, P<0.05) ; mean rank of reduced motivation were significant statistical difference among the military officers, sergeancy and soldier group (F=18.965, P<0.05) ; mean rank of general fatigue scores were significant statistical difference among the military officers, sergeancy and soldier group (F=14.711, P<0.05) . The score of negative coping style were positively correlated with the score of physical fatigue (rs=0.129) , reduced activity (rs=0.123) , reduced motivation (rs=0.149) and general fatigue (rs=0.174) respectively, the score of organizational support lack strength were positively correlated with the score of physical fatigue (rs=0.090) , reduced activity (rs=0.098) , reduced motivation (rs=0.099) and general fatigue (rs=0.130) respectively. The mediator effect of negative coping style on the job stress and fatigue was 0.013 (P<0.01) .@*Conclusion@#The fatigue statuses of the urban (town) group and the up or equal 20-years old age group are poor, and the negative coping style plays mediator effect on the job stress and fatigue.

BACKGROUND: The measurement of handgrip strength (HGS) has prognostic value with respect to all-cause mortality, cardiovascular mortality and cardiovascular disease, and is an important part of the evaluation of frailty. Published reference ranges for HGS are mostly derived from Caucasian populations in high-income countries. There is a paucity of information on normative HGS values in non-Caucasian populations from low- or middle-income countries. The objective of this study was to develop reference HGS ranges for healthy adults from a broad range of ethnicities and socioeconomically diverse geographic regions. METHODS: HGS was measured using a Jamar dynamometer in 125,462 healthy adults aged 35-70 years from 21 countries in the Prospective Urban Rural Epidemiology (PURE) study. RESULTS: HGS values differed among individuals from different geographic regions. HGS values were highest among those from Europe/North America, lowest among those from South Asia, South East Asia and Africa, and intermediate among those from China, South America, and the Middle East. Reference ranges stratified by geographic region, age, and sex are presented. These ranges varied from a median (25th-75th percentile) 50 kg (43-56 kg) in men <40 years from Europe/North America to 18 kg (14-20 kg) in women >60 years from South East Asia. Reference ranges by ethnicity and body-mass index are also reported. CONCLUSIONS: Individual HGS measurements should be interpreted using region/ethnic-specific reference ranges.

ObjectiveTo understand the implementation effect and its influencing factors of clinical medical undergraduates' talents cultivation scheme in Xinjiang Medical University. Methods 421 clinical medical students completed questionnaire. The main contents of the survey are general situation, the factors and the implementation effect of the cultivation scheme, and so on. Results①The talents cultivation scheme is reasonable and feasible. ②The main factors which affect talents cultivation scheme of our school are the teaching plan arrangement and practical course arrangement. ③Talents cultivation scheme in the implementation process achieved some success, but the cultivation of humanistic quality should be enhanced, etc. ConclusionRenewed the education conception, optimize the clinical teaching structure, integrated teaching contents, updated teaching methods and means, and strengthened students' humanistic quality are the key factors of the higher medical institutions to cultivate high quality and comprehensive talents.
